DURATION

Classroom contact hours of approx 410 hrs.: However, the actual total input provided to the student is more than 540 hours which includes
  • doubt removal sessions
  • Rank Improvement Program
  • Phase Tests and Tests of All India Test Series
  • Test Analysis Sessions etc.
Normally classes are held 4 days a week for 4 hrs. each time. Each phase is followed by 1 week of study leave, followed by a Phase Test. Classes can be held in the morning or evening session
